No elevator, so make sure you know which types of rooms are available -- 2 queen rooms were only available on the second floor. The front desk staff was great and moved us to a room with working fridge and microwave. WiFi was good. Shower pressure was excellent as were the towels. We needed a tub stopper for the bath which was delivered to the room, but not everyone takes baths. TV worked as did the A/C.

Other than this hotel being well-worn, it was a satisfactory location for my one night stay. The TV lost reception shortly after my arrival at 10 pm but did return to service in the morning. Breakfast is my only complaint since the cost the night was comperable to many other local hotels but without the complimentary breakfast. A bag including a child-sized artificially flavoured juice box, hard granola and vanilla yogurt cut isn't close to an adult's expectation for breakfast. Coffee and tea were available 24 hrs in the lobby to which I had to walk the length of the hotel for my morning beverage.

The location was awesome. We were close to just about anything we needed or wanted, and in a lot of cases within easy walking distance. Staff were great, very friendly and helpful. Room we stayed in was very dated. AC unit wasn't working properly, we asked for a fan which staff did quickly bring us. Mattresses were quite comfortable though there was an indentation from where previous customers had slept. Our room also had glue or something on the mirror in the bathroom which was weird and a bit offputting. Overall cleanliness was great. We had breakfast included but weren't up early enough to partake so I'm not sure how it was.

Our room was absolutely disgusting. The carpet was so dirty, that when I accidentally dropped a pair of clean socks on it, I threw it back into the "dirty laundry" bag because I didn't feel comfortable wearing them.
The bed cover was dirty and dusty so we removed it as well and were quite cold at night because there were no other covers, and when we called the front desk, there was no answer.
At night, the walls are so thin that we heard everyone's conversations in the hallway at 2am, and could hear our neighbours move around in their room. Everytime someone opened a door to their room, it was so loud, we thought it was someone opening our door and we remained awake at night thinking someone was going to break into the room.
I truly feel that they shouldn't be charging over $100 for these rooms, and think they should actually not rent these rooms out at all. I can see that other reviews seem to state that some rooms are renovated, but this room was obviously not cleaned since the 70's or so.
Please don't waste your money here.
